Job Description / Tasks / Responsibilities

Is responsible for implementing the Chemistry Program for Radiation Protection / Chemistry Department at a TMI2. Ensures facilities and projects comply with applicable laws, rules, policies and procedures regulating radiation safety. Compiles compliance reports and oversees regulatory recordkeeping and submission of reports to regulatory agencies.

Provides oversight, direction and training to organization staff to ensure all radiation and chemistry activities related to a site, program, project, function and / or facility process(es) are conducted in compliance with established rules, regulations, policies and procedures and to ensure high quality products and services for EnergySolutions customers.

Supervises various chemistry and radiation safety disciplines such as radiological engineering, dosimetry, instrumentation, waste management and health physics.

Manages the development and implementation of training programs for staff on technical compliance procedures.

Ensures compliance with all local, state and federal laws and regulations pertaining to facility operations.

Develops and implements radiation / chemistry procedures for the site.

Provides training for radiation / chemistry department staff to ensure compliance with site procedures.

Manages the implementation of chemistry / radiation safety procedures in response to new regulations at the federal, state and local levels.

Compiles compliance reports and oversees regulatory recordkeeping and submission of reports to regulatory agencies.

Follows organizational policies and procedures and ensures staff is in compliance.

Performs lab analysis and reporting.

Perform sample anlysis using gamma spectrometers, alpha spectrometers, beta-gamma bencg counters and alpha couters

Processes samples using a liquid scintillator and tri-carb.

Stays current on local, state, federal and EnergySolutions policies and procedures concerning shipment / transportation of radioactive materials.

Collects, analyzes various samples required to ensure compliance with the ODCM (as applicable), local, state and federal radiation safety regulations and orders and environmental technical standards, guidelines and policies.

Ensures proper operation and maintenance of chemistry / count room equipment..
